Default Black Split Key Ring for Sto 'N Sho

I ordered some black split key rings that are the same guage and diameter as the stainless split key ring that came with the Sto 'N Sho, in an attempt to make the ring a bit less visible under the bumper.

Unfortunately, I had to order 50 of them. If anyone would like a few, PM me a shipping address and I'll throw some in an envelope and mail them out to you, on me.

If you would prefer to order them yourself, I got them from Amazon here:
